Good for Value

I played this course back end of April. The positives are that the greens were excellent and running fast and the back nine layout is very picturesque with rolling fairways through mature trees. The front nine is not a great layout with blind tee shots and at times greens that were almost too small.
The overall condition was scruffy but I did only pay 31 dollars with a buggy.

Donald Ross Gem in the Peidmont

The front 9 is a Donald Ross design with deep greenside bunkers and smallish greens. Elevation changes are prominent on most holes. The green complexes really shine with no 2 alike. Greens pitch front to back and back to front and all manner of sideway tilt-keeps you guessing! The inward 9 is fun with ample challenge on your drive to work the ball both ways. Overall an enjoyable round of golf.
